On 2014-01-29, Maciej Milewski <milu@dat.pl> wrote: > On 28.01.2014 18:13, James Griffin wrote: >> On 2014-01-28, Matthias Apitz <guru@unixarea.de> wrote: >> >>> If you have /dev/dsp and /dev/mixer the default file >>> /compat/linux/etc/alsa/pcm/pcm-oss.conf will work; >>> >>> matthias >>> >> Ok, got Skype with microphone working. >> >> Had to edit the file /compat/linux/etc/alsa/pcm/pcm-oss.conf >> >> pcm.oss2 { >> ... >> device /dev/dsp2 >> ... >> Description " ... Webcam" >> } >> >> ctl.oss2 { >> ... >> device /dev/mixer2 >> ... >> Description " ... Webcam" >> } >> >> ... added to the file. So essentially adding a second copy of the text >> in there with a second device number; in my case, I chose 2 because >> that's what dmesg | grep uaudio showed the camera had been attached to. >> >> Hope that makes sense??? > > As long as that works fine - that makes sense :) > > Maciej Yep, it works well.
